Cripple Crow was released on XL Recordings on September 13, 2005. It is the fifth album by psych folk acoustic rocker Devendra Banhart and his first for the label XL Recordings.
All tracks by Devendra Banhart
The CD release of this album also includes an MP3 bonus track "White Reggae Troll/Africa".
The double LP release of this album includes eight additional tracks, as well as an alternate cover of the normal album cover replaced with photographs of Devendra's own fans.
